Eavestrough Clearing in Arvada, CO
Eavestrough clearing services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t from the gutters to ensure proper water flow away from the property. These projects typically include cleaning gutters on residential homes, especially after seasonal changes or storms, and can also involve inspecting the system for any signs of damage or blockages. Homeowners often request this service to prevent water overflow, which can lead to foundation issues, basement flooding, or damage to exterior walls and landscaping.
Property owners should consider the size and height of their home, the condition of their gutters, and any specific concerns about blockages or leaks before requesting eavestrough clearing. It’s also helpful to determine if additional repairs or maintenance, such as gutter repairs or installation of guards, may be needed in conjunction with cleaning. Properly maintained gutters contribute to the overall health of the property by directing water efficiently and preventing potential water-related problems.

Common Eavestrough Clearing Jobs
Eavestrough Cleaning - removal of debris to ensure proper water flow and prevent blockages.
Gutter Inspection - assessment of eavestroughs to identify leaks, damage, or clogs.
Downspout Clearing - clearing of downspouts to prevent overflow and water damage.
Gutter Flushing - thorough rinsing to remove dirt, leaves, and buildup inside the system.
Gutter Maintenance - routine checks and minor repairs to keep eavestroughs functioning effectively.
Gutter Replacement - installation of new eavestroughs when repairs are no longer sufficient.
Eavestrough Clearing Questions
What is eavestrough clearing? Eavestrough clearing involves removing leaves, debris, and obstructions from gutters to ensure proper water flow away from the property.
Why is regular eavestrough maintenance important? Regular cleaning helps prevent water damage, foundation issues, and pest infestations caused by clogged gutters.
How often should gutters be cleaned? Gutters should typically be cleaned at least twice a year, especially during fall and spring, or more frequently if there are many trees nearby.
What signs indicate that gutters need cleaning? Signs include overflowing water, sagging gutters, water stains on the exterior walls, or visible debris in the troughs.
